What is a custom wedding website and what value does it have?

A wedding website can showcase all the info your guests need in one handy place: From travel and accommodation information, to your registry links, to fun facts about the bridal party, to the love story about how you and partner met.

As for how you’re going to get value out of it, think of it this way. It’s the chance to expand on what’s printed on your paper invitations without having to spend more money on printing it all up for wedding guests. Plus, it’s handy if you need to send any updates to guests. That way, they can just check online without you having to spend more money on printed-paper and postage.

As the big day gets closer, you can also update the website with the weekend’s schedule, directions, and things to do in the area so you don’t have to print these up for wedding guests coming in from out of town.

How much will you spend on your own wedding website?

Setting up your initial website on Zola.com is free. However, some other domains you might see online do charge you a fee to use them as a host for your wedding website. They may also charge you to create a custom domain. (i.e. bradandjenwedding.com) And finally, there may be a yearly fee to renew your website. Always read the fine print carefully before you hand over your credit card.

To get started on your Zola custom free wedding website, you’ll just need to enter your name and the name of your spouse-to-be, plus the date of your upcoming nuptials. Then you’ll enter your email address and create a password for the account (keep this handy) and choose a custom design template. Then you can customize it with all the wedding details you want like the schedule, travel accommodations, the wedding party, photos, and your registry. If you want a custom domain, you can add one to your Zola site starting at $14.95. You can also redirect a domain you purchased elsewhere to your Zola website. Find out more on how to do that here. (A custom domain for a website usually costs between $10 and $20 a year.)

Other personal wedding website costs

  • Engagement Photos: You can use any old photos you have of you and your fiancé for your own wedding website. But professional engagement photos look amazing on your custom Zola template! If you want to have a professional engagement photo shoot and are planning to use some of those photos for the wedding site, expect to spend between $250 and $1,000 for the session and prints or downloads.
